Key Insights of Japan O-chlorobenzonitrile Market

  • Market size estimated at approximately USD 150 million in 2023, with steady growth driven by pharmaceutical and agrochemical applications.
  • Projected CAGR of 6.2% from 2026 to 2033, reflecting rising demand for specialty chemicals in Japan’s innovation-driven economy.
  • Major segments include pharmaceutical intermediates (dominant), agrochemical synthesis, and specialty polymers, with pharmaceuticals leading due to stringent regulatory standards.
  • Key geographic dominance by Japan’s domestic manufacturers, with emerging export opportunities in Southeast Asia and North America.
  • Significant growth opportunities exist in sustainable production methods and green chemistry initiatives aligned with Japan’s environmental policies.
  • Leading players include Mitsubishi Chemical, Sumitomo Chemical, and Toray Industries, with increasing R&D investments to enhance product purity and process efficiency.

Japan O-chlorobenzonitrile Market Dynamics and Industry Landscape

The Japanese market for O-chlorobenzonitrile is characterized by a mature yet innovation-driven landscape. The industry’s evolution is marked by a transition from traditional manufacturing to advanced, environmentally compliant processes. The market’s growth is underpinned by robust demand from pharmaceutical companies seeking high-purity intermediates for drug synthesis, especially in oncology and cardiovascular therapies. Additionally, agrochemical manufacturers leverage O-chlorobenzonitrile as a key precursor in pesticide formulations, further fueling demand.

Competitive positioning is influenced by Japan’s strict regulatory environment, which compels manufacturers to adopt high-quality standards and sustainable practices. The industry’s maturity is reflected in high entry barriers, significant R&D investments, and a focus on process innovation. Supply chain resilience and raw material sourcing are critical factors, with local suppliers maintaining strategic advantages. The market’s long-term outlook remains positive, driven by technological advancements and increasing global demand for Japanese-origin specialty chemicals.
